Abstract

A space division system ( 100 ) is disclosed, with the space division system ( 100 ) incorporating technology. The space division system ( 100 ) is disclosed as having a space divider ( 102 ) vertically suspended from a rail system ( 104 ). The rail system ( 104 ) includes a rail ( 106 ) with a pair of hanger clips ( 108 ) releasably secured to the rail ( 106 ) and capable of being moved along a continuum of the length of the rail ( 106 ). In one embodiment, the space divider ( 102 ) includes a main body ( 114 ) consisting of an opaque fabric. Associated with the main body ( 114 ) is lighting technology including a series of LED lights ( 116 ). Arrow lights ( 118 ) may be activated in an appropriate manner for emergency or other purposes. Color changing is also provided for purposes of wayfinding, signaling occupant activities or other external or internal circumstances.
